E-cadherin promotes proliferation of human ovarian cancer cells in vitro via activating MEK/ERK pathway

AIM: E-cadherin is unusually highly expressed in most ovarian cancers. This study was designed to investigate the roles of E-cadherin in the carcinogenesis and progression of ovarian cancers.
